Understanding Listeria and Its Risks

Listeria monocytogenes is a gram-positive, rod-shaped bacterium that is a major public health concern due to its role as a foodborne pathogen. It can cause severe illness, particularly in pregnant women, the elderly, and individuals with weakened immune systems. Foods that are commonly associated with a risk of Listeria contamination include soft cheeses, hot dogs, deli meats, and unpasteurized dairy products. It is essential to handle and cook these foods properly to prevent infection.

The Importance of Cooking and Reheating

Cooking and reheating foods to the appropriate temperatures can kill Listeria. The minimum internal temperature required to ensure that harmful bacteria, including Listeria, are killed varies depending on the type of food. Generally, an internal temperature of 165°F (74°C) is recommended for most foods. However, achieving this temperature evenly throughout the food, especially in dense or bulky items, can be challenging.

Microwaving as a Method to Kill Listeria

Microwaving can be an effective way to reheat food to a temperature that kills Listeria, provided it is done correctly. The key factor is ensuring that the food reaches an internal temperature of at least 165°F (74°C) throughout. However, due to the uneven heating nature of microwaves, there’s a risk of some parts not reaching this critical temperature, especially in thicker portions of food.

Tips for Safe Microwaving

  • Cover the food: This helps to promote even heating and prevent splatters, which can spread bacteria around the microwave.
  • Use a food thermometer: The only reliable way to ensure that your food has reached a safe internal temperature is by using a food thermometer.
  • Stir and rotate: For liquids or soups, stir them halfway through the heating time. For solid foods, rotate them for even heating.
  • Avoid overheating: While the goal is to reach a temperature that kills Listeria, overheating can lead to the formation of harmful compounds or a decrease in the food’s nutritional value.

Time Guidelines for Microwaving

The time needed to microwave food to a safe temperature varies widely depending on the type of food, its thickness, the power level of the microwave, and whether the food is frozen or fresh. As a general rule, it’s better to reheat in shorter intervals, checking the temperature until it reaches 165°F (74°C), rather than relying on a single, longer heating time. For example, if reheating a chicken breast, you might start with 30-second intervals, checking the temperature after each interval until it reaches the safe minimum.

Cooking from Frozen

Some foods, like frozen dinners or vegetables, can be cooked directly from the frozen state in the microwave. Always follow the cooking instructions provided on the packaging, and use a food thermometer to verify that the food has reached a safe internal temperature. It’s also important to note that some frozen foods may require standing time after microwaving to allow the heat to distribute evenly, ensuring that all parts of the food reach a safe temperature.

How can I verify that Listeria has been killed during microwaving?

Verifying that Listeria has been killed during microwaving requires attention to proper food safety practices and the use of a food thermometer. The most reliable way to verify that Listeria has been killed is to check the food’s internal temperature, as this will indicate whether the food has reached a safe temperature. It is essential to use a food thermometer to check the internal temperature of the food, particularly when reheating leftovers or cooking frozen foods. The thermometer should be inserted into the thickest part of the food, avoiding any bones or fat, and the temperature should be checked periodically during reheating to ensure that the food reaches a safe temperature.
